Output 24b9d75bda2af89ed1152a1a5e5215ac5eafc72e128726aa4ec323436b57e23c:0

value
185528555
script pubkey
OP_0 OP_PUSHBYTES_20 dd7febcf3fe48c1f12ae90cb13d5630fbfda2bd9
address
bc1qm4l7hnelujxp7y4wjr9384trp7la527eezrw69
transaction
24b9d75bda2af89ed1152a1a5e5215ac5eafc72e128726aa4ec323436b57e23c
confirmations
396075
spent
true